Internal memo — weekly cash-box run, Pellant Office Services. The Friday cash box must be counted by two staff, sealed in the numbered pouch, and logged in the blue ledger before 10:00. Greta from Fernhill Secure Transit collects between 10:15 and 10:45; she will present her collection card at the front desk. Do not release the pouch without the ledger countersigned. The confidential courier hand-over instruction for this week is set out immediately below.

dispatch memo: the druius wenael courier leaves the sorion ledger at gate 9642 under passcode 952292

Handover: Fernloop shipping-fees rules engine. Quick notes before I'm out — the rate tables live in the rules DSL repo, and zone overrides beat carrier defaults (that bit me twice). Regression suite runs nightly; don't trust green until the snapshot diff passes. The staging secrets vault reseals on deploy, so when it locks, unseal it with the passphrase below.

unlock words, fafop-hawep: briwyn-oliix-sorox

## Alert: StatRelay Sidecar Flush Lag

This alert fires when the StatRelay metrics-aggregation sidecar falls more than 120 seconds behind on flushing buffered samples to the Coalmine backend. Plugin-emitted counters are buffered in-process, so sustained lag usually means a plugin is emitting unbounded label cardinality or blocking the flush thread. Check your plugin's metric registration against the published cardinality limits before escalating. If the lag persists after your plugin is ruled out, contact the telemetry team.

escalation mailbox, bagug-fahof: novdor.wendor.jormir@norvalabs.example

Budget Request — Managers Only (Sales Leads), Hartwell Courier Group

Heads-up: we're putting in for an extra field-demo budget next quarter. The Norbury team burned through theirs early and the demos are clearly converting, so we want room to keep momentum. Ask is modest — mostly travel and loaner kits. Push any objections to me by Friday. The confidential note on related business plans is below.

confidential, kagep-kahof: Druokax Systems plans to lower the Ulaath list price by 53 percent in March.